If you love the outdoors, we have a spot for you! Our Eco-literacy Coordinator, Brett Bloom, will be working hard this fall on the campus gardens: one is a perennial fruit & vegetable garden for imaginative immersive experience and learning, the other is a production garden to present students with different ways of cultivating food. This work can take place Tuesday, Thursdays, or Fridays, anytime between 9am and 12pm.
